Transaction 33a62308c3173d881771d7067f3893ced3093e4acf9f0072dda85ffa7848430b
1 Input
1 Output
-
33a62308c3173d881771d7067f3893ced3093e4acf9f0072dda85ffa7848430b:0
- value
- 1612277
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9b77987a17b3d5ea9d1c50b7836c7bed541b840 OP_EQUAL
- address
- 3Jczj5amKmtgM5XQTyNf9LxSY4U6N4Mstn